Assessing the Compounding Trade Policy Effects Shaping Commercial High Bay LED Pricing Supply Chains and Sourcing Strategies in the US Market
The imposition of additional duties under recent United States trade policy measures has materially influenced the commercial high bay LED market, prompting supply chain realignments and cost management strategies. Tariffs introduced in early 2025 have targeted key components and finished luminaires, elevating the landed cost of imports from certain manufacturing hubs. As a result, many lighting organizations have reevaluated their sourcing footprints, exploring near-shoring opportunities in Mexico and Southeast Asia to mitigate exposure to high duty rates and logistical bottlenecks.
In response to this evolving trade environment, manufacturers have adopted a combination of tariff engineering, inventory stocking, and direct partnerships with domestic suppliers. By redesigning fixture architectures to incorporate locally sourced drivers and extrusions, companies are able to reduce the effective duty burden while preserving product performance characteristics. These adaptive strategies underscore the critical need for agility in procurement planning and reinforce the growing importance of diversified manufacturing networks to safeguard supply continuity.
Unveiling Diverse Market Dynamics through Comprehensive Analysis across Product Types Wattage Ranges Industries and Distribution Channels
A nuanced understanding of market segmentation reveals significant variation in demand and growth patterns across different product types, wattage categories, end use industries, applications, distribution channels, mounting styles, and project scopes. Integrated high bay luminaires continue to attract interest for their streamlined installation and high lumen efficacy, while modular designs offer customizable photometric distributions for specialized facility layouts. Linear and UFO high bay variants have also found traction among customers seeking balance between performance and aesthetic considerations.
When considering wattage preferences, projects that demand 100 to 200 watts account for a sizable share of new deployments, driven by standard ceiling heights and mid-sized facility footprints. Conversely, above-200-watt fixtures serve large warehouses and heavy manufacturing plants, and below-100-watt solutions address retrofit scenarios in low-bay or mezzanine areas. End use segmentation further differentiates market dynamics. While traditional commercial segments such as hospitality, recreation, and retail spaces emphasize design flexibility and brand alignment, industrial verticals-encompassing automotive, food processing, manufacturing, and warehousing-prioritize ruggedness and photometric precision. Distribution center and third-party logistics sites demand robust lighting that maximizes energy savings under continuous operation. Within retail environments, convenience stores, department stores, and supermarkets each present distinct performance and aesthetic benchmarks. Mounting and installation type choices, whether utilizing hook, pendant, or surface options and addressing new builds or retrofit projects, further refine purchasing criteria and manufacturer value propositions.

Exploring Regional Variations and Growth Drivers across Americas EMEA and Asia-Pacific Commercial High Bay LED Markets
Regional disparities in commercial high bay LED adoption reflect a complex interplay between regulatory frameworks, energy initiatives, and infrastructure development priorities. In the Americas, mature energy efficiency programs and rebate incentives have accelerated retrofit campaigns across warehousing and logistics hubs, while expansion of new distribution centers continues to underpin demand in key U.S. and Canadian markets. Progressive building codes in states like California and New York have further bolstered the case for advanced LED installations, compelling facility managers to seek integrated controls and daylight harvesting capabilities.
Meanwhile, the Europe, Middle East & Africa region showcases heterogeneous growth patterns. Western European nations, driven by stringent EU directives on energy consumption and carbon reduction, exhibit robust receptivity to intelligent lighting systems. The Middle East, buoyed by large-scale construction and industrial projects, favors high lumen output and durability under challenging environmental conditions. In Africa, nascent infrastructure upgrades coupled with urbanization trends are fostering incremental adoption, particularly among distribution centers and manufacturing parks. The Asia-Pacific landscape is characterized by dual dynamics: China remains a dominant manufacturing hub with significant domestic consumption, while markets such as Japan and South Korea emphasize precision lighting and advanced automation. Emerging Southeast Asian economies are rapidly modernizing commercial and industrial facilities, presenting attractive opportunities for cost-competitive, locally optimized LED offerings.
